The TSi MCC has set the international standard for Nodal MCCs. In additional to its function as a national MCC, a Nodal MCC is responsible for providing the link between the international community and other MCCs and OCCs in its region of responsibility. For example, all alert messages between the international community and the Canadian MCC, a MCC in the USMCC's region of responsibility, must first be sent to the USMCC. Thus, a Nodal MCC serves as the international hub for its region of responsibility. A Nodal MCC contributes to the overall stability of the COSPAS-SARSAT system. A Nodal MCC is more powerful than conventional MCCs and OCCs. The TSi PrecisionSAR RCC Workstation provides effective management and coordination of a SAR effort by linking information from the COSPAS-SARSAT system with a map complete with a graphical information system (GIS). The GIS map is based on the Digital Chart of the World for presentation of geographical information. The map data is tuned to provide the greatest amount of information for the national area of responsibility. This includes roads, rivers, lakes, population centers, airports, geographic elevations, and ocean features. |
